HTML与XHTML区别

来源:互联网 发布:电脑c盘的windows文件 编辑:程序博客网 时间:2024/05/19 23:27

======================================================
注:本文源代码点此下载
======================================================

1、xhtml元素必须被正确地嵌套

2、xhtml 元素必须被关闭,空标签也必须被关闭。如

3、xhtml 元素必须小写

4、xhtml 文档必须拥有一个根元素

5、xhtml属性名称必须小写,属性值必须加引号,属性不能简写。如:

6、xhtml用 id 属性代替 name 属性。

注意:应该在 "/" 符号前添加一个额外的空格,以使你的 xhtml 与当今的浏览器相兼容

7、语言属性(lang)lang 属性应用于几乎所有的 xhtml 元素。它定义元素内部的内容的所用语言的类型。如果在某元素中使用 lang 属性,就必须添加额外的 xml:lang,像这样:

lang="no" xml:lang="no">heia norge!

xhtml 1.0 的三种 xml 文档类型

xhtml 1.0 规定了三种 xml 文档类型,以对应上述三种 dtd。

xhtml 1.0 strict

xhtml1-strict.dtd">

在此情况下使用:需要干净的标记,避免表现上的混乱。请与层叠样式表配合使用。

xhtml 1.0 transitional

xhtml1-transitional.dtd">

在此情况下使用:当需要利用 html 在表现上的特性时,并且当需要为那些不支持层叠样式表的浏览器编写 xhtml 时。

xhtml 1.0 frameset

xhtml1-frameset.dtd">

在此的情况下使用:需要使用html框架将浏览器窗口分割为两部分或更多框架时。


======================================================
在最后,我邀请大家参加新浪APP,就是新浪免费送大家的一个空间,支持PHP+MySql,免费二级域名,免费域名绑定 这个是我邀请的地址,您通过这个链接注册即为我的好友,并获赠云豆500个,价值5元哦!短网址是http://t.cn/SXOiLh我创建的小站每天访客已经达到2000+了,每天挂广告赚50+元哦,呵呵,饭钱不愁了,\(^o^)/
原创粉丝点击